The five ground-floor bedrooms are individually designed and have year-round central heating or air conditioning.
Many home comforts include complimentary wi-fi access, direct-dial telephone, remote-controlled digital flatscreen television with Freeview and video/dvd, clock cd/radio, armchair/s, wardrobe with safe and shoe cleaning polish and brushes, dressing table, hair dryer, hearing loop, trouser press and fresh flowers or plant.
Quality linen bedding is complemented by allergen-proof Quallofil® pillows (feather pillows are available upon request), blankets and hot water bottle/s.
Rooms have well-stocked refrigerators with organic semi-skimmed milk, fruit juices, New Forest Spring Water and snacks, also tea/coffee-making facilities, fresh fruit, biscuits and many little extras.
Ensuite bathrooms feature traditional cast iron/pressed steel baths and/or shower cubicles with seats, washbasin, close coupled toilet, appropriate grab rails, coordinated luxury towels and face flannels, White Company toiletries, bathroom scales and direct-dial telephone for emergency use.

We are proud of our reputation for “the remarkable level of provision for the less able visitor” (Condé Nast Johansens). We received the Judges Award for Excellence in Continuing Commitment to the Interests of Disabled People in the 2004 Southampton Centre for Independent Living Awards.
Judging the Access for All Tourism ExSEllence Awards 2008, Brian Seaman was “particularly taken with the provision of access for older and disabled people, not only in terms of facilities for ambulant wheelchair users but also for those with a visual impairment or hearing loss”. He described some of the facilities such as bedroom hearing loops, Big Button telephones and shake awake alarm clocks as “really unusual and ground breaking”.
The Cottage was for many years home to Sway’s successive District Nurses, after whom the bedrooms are named (some dates are approximate):
1913-18 Liddell (pronounced Liddle) is a Single with shower (4ft. 6ins. double bed),
1918-27 Lloyd is the Superior Twin/Kingsize Double with bath and shower (6ft. double or 2 × 3ft. single beds),
1927-37 Southerden is also a flexible room with bath and can be configured as Twin or Kingsize Double (6ft. double or 2 × 3ft. single beds),
1937-67 Lipscombe is our Classic Single with bath (3ft. single bed),
and 1967-83 Gibson, the Cottage’s original master bedroom, is our Classic Double (4ft. 6ins. double bed).
